BETHLEHEM TOWNSHIP, PA — The Bethlehem Township Police Department announced the discovery of a lost dog on March 11 around 4 p.m. The dog was found in the 4000 block of Wilson Avenue. Those who recognize the dog or know its owner are urged to contact the non-emergency dispatch at 610.759.2200.

Wolfman Jack was a renowned American disc jockey, famous for his gravelly voice and distinctive persona. He became a cultural icon in the 1960s and 1970s, known for his wild, energetic personality and his significant impact on the radio and music industries.
